From the moment you step onto the pitch, FIFA 09 challenges you to think and react like a real football player through the popular feature innovation Be A Pro - now expanded to multiple seasons and featuring the unique Be A Pro camera that tracks your player, re-creating the excitement and rush of racing in on goal. Plus, four new skill moves - scoop turns, rainbow flicks, heel-to-heel knocks and ball rolls – give you a total of 32 tricks in your arsenal to perform just like Ronaldinho. Tuned acceleration attributes enable swifter players to possess quicker first steps and gain advantage in sprints. Changes to the animation system reward the skillful gamer during one-on-one situations between attackers and defenders. Stronger players possess the strength to knock down smaller players or use their body and arms to shield the ball in challenges. Plus, contact occurs with shoulders, arms and legs. Player speed, direction and strength now determine everything from the severity of the collision to the outcome of possession. Hundreds of new animation sequences and a new collision detection system with 360 degree coverage enable players to behave according to their physical attributes. If you perform poorly, you will be given fewer games and, eventually, fired. You will become the captain of your team and may be called up to represent your country if you perform well. Your performance will be evaluated after each game. Be a Pro mode allows you to control a single player throughout a season and play match by match. In addition to the usual updated graphics and rosters, the portable version now includes the “Be a Pro” mode that the console versions have had for the previous two iterations. As with previous FIFA games, you can control a team and put it through its paces game by game, season by season. This PSP edition differs from the high-end console and PC versions in several ways. FIFA Soccer 2009 is the ninth installment in the long-running FIFA football game series.
